1961-05-21 Β· Day game Β· Wrigley Field Β· 50Β°F, cloudy, dry Β· 3:20
St. Louis Cardinals defeated Chicago Cubs 6β3. St. Louis Cardinals put up 3 in the 9th. Lindy McDaniel earned the win. Stan Musial went 3-for-5 with 1 HR and 5 RBI.
